Concept of New Towns

 World civilization is growing and cities are expanding to their outer city limit which leads to an urban sprawl and the formation of suburbs. Specialized city suburbs have been developed over time which eventually separates the inhabitant’s social connection from the main city center. As a result, the city has exceeded its outer boundaries and leaves limited space for further urban development. When population and housing demands increased, government authorities, sought out for new and other options; the development of new towns. 

New town, a form of urban planning designed to relocate populations away from large cities by grouping homes, hospitals, industry and cultural, recreational, and shopping centres to form entirely new, relatively autonomous communities. The first new towns were proposed in Great Britain in the New Towns Act of 1946; between 1947 and 1950, 12 were designated in England and Wales and 2 in Scotland, each with its own development corporation financed by the government. The new towns were located in relatively undeveloped sites. Each was to have an admixture of population so as to give it a balanced social life. 

A new town is a new settlement built on either rural land transformed to urban land use or on new reclaimed land. The objective of developing new towns is to become a self-sufficient town. New towns seem to be the answer to the urban sprawl and suburban dilemma where there are low economic job opportunities creating a high percentage of commuting. This however becomes a mutual problem for new towns as they evolve making them dependent on neighboring towns and cities for employment and various types of social services. Another issue that new towns have to deal with is the identity crisis which links to its lack of history. This therefore leads people to the misconception of new towns as suburbs.

A more consistent definition of a new town is best described by the International New Town Institute as (INTI) human settlements that were founded at a certain moment in history by an explicit act of will, according to a preceding plan and aiming to survive as a self-sustaining local community and independent local government, able to play a role in the ongoing development of the region in which the new town is located. 

A new town has been interpreted as a relocation of housing for overpopulated cities or a safe suburban living area for the middle class family. A new town is not an extension of an existing town or city. It is a blueprint plan of a new settlement before it was built. New towns were also characterized as a new concept of lifestyle: ‘living in a green and healthy environment’ after much destruction to existing cities and towns during World War II. New Towns became the answer to divert over populated and congested cities to a new location of a new town. The development of new towns has served as relocation for the over spill of existing cities. It should not be forgotten that new towns also exploits rural land that may have served for other land use developments such as for farmland or nature and recreation area.

TOD principles cannot be applied uniformly across an entire city or transit network, since densities of jobs and people vary widely across the urban space. In fact, experience has shown that only about 15% of transit stations and their surrounding area can support very high density development. 
To make informed decisions about TOD, research institutions and governments have developed a variety of methodologies that can help identify which station areas are good candidates for TOD, determine what level of density the area around a given station can absorb, and figure out what kind of development mix makes sense in a particular area, looking to strike the right balance between jobs, housing and other amenities. 
Building on these approaches, the report proposes a new framework for guiding TOD plans, by simultaneously assessing the “three values” (3V) of transit stations and surrounding areas:
  • The Node value describes the importance of a station in the public transit network based on passenger traffic, connections with other transport modes and centrality within the network. 
  • The Place value reflects the quality and attractiveness of the area around the station. Factors include the diversity of land use; the availability of essential services such as schools and healthcare; the proportion of everyday amenities that can be accessed by walking or cycling; pedestrian accessibility and also the size of urban blocks around the station. 
  • The Market potential value refers to the unrealized market value of station areas. It is measured by looking at the major variables that can influence the demand for land (current and future number of jobs in the vicinity of the station, number of jobs accessible by transit within 30 minutes, current and future housing densities) as well as the supply (amount of developable land, possible changes in zoning policy, market vibrancy etc.). 
The report presents an approach to identify and address potential imbalances between node, place and market potential values to create new economic opportunities, for example, by improving the urban environment around a major transit hub, or by improving public transit service to a booming area. The tool provides a common framework of assessment for urban, transport, and economic planners, thereby facilitating conversations needed for better economic, land use, and transport integration.

New Towns in India

 In recent times, India has seen a spurt in such planned townships and a significant number of consumers living in major urban centres are becoming interested in the idea of living in the number of planned townships that are being built away from major urban hubs and chaos. 

Making of new towns in India is not a recent phenomenon. India has the experience of this process throughout her history. The phenomenal growth of new towns in India bears the imprint of her heritage in this field of culture and civilization. Mohenjodaro and Harappa, dating back to the Indus Valley civilization, Ayodhya, Pataliputra (present Patna) and Varanasi laid out by Indo Aryans during the Vedic period, Nalanda and Taxila built to serve as University towns during the Buddhist period. Agra, Golconda and “Dacca” (Bangladesh) of mediaeval period, Fatehpur Sikri of the Moghul period, Jaipur the ‘pink city built by Maharaja Jai Singh during the 18th century and Lutyen’s New Delhi (1930) are some of the classic examples of new towns built to satisfy the needs and aspirations of urban community during different periods. 

The new town movement of India in the recent past is associated with the beginning of railway towns of British India. These railway towns being formed of an assortment of quarter, for railway employees, stations and other transportational facilities made a sizeable settlement with minimum possible layout and service facilities. The towns mainly designed on ‘grid iron’ pattern and provided community facilities like market, temples, churches, schools, playground, cinema and theatre gave the look of a new town. Kharagpur, Asansol, Tundla, Manmad and Waltair are the landmarks in this field of new towns in colonial India. 

By 1941, India had more than 30 such towns having capacity of more than 10,000 people each. Till independence development of new towns followed this pattern with a few exceptions like Jamshedpur. Development of new towns in the truest sense in India took a turn after independence. The partition of the country in 1947 resulted in influx of refugees from east and west and their rehabilitation marked the beginning of new towns in modern India. Faridabad near Delhi, Nilokheri in Punjab, Gandhidham in Gujarat and Asokenagar in West Bengal are examples of refugee township in India. 

The new towns built in the first phase lack in design aspect and differ from European and American Standards. But it should be admitted that India started making new towns at a very difficult hour. It was Pandit Jahawarlal Nehru, the then Prime Minister of India wished decent layout of these new townships. He invited the great designer from France, viz. Le Corbusier and gave him the task of designing Chandigarh. His architectural designs and creations became a source of inspiration to other young nations. Creation of Chandigarh was a historic moment in the contemporary annals of town planning. In fact Chandigarh was the ‘flag off” stage in the race of town building in India.

1) Navi Mumbai 

Navi Mumbai is a planned satellite township of Mumbai on the west coast of Maharashtra. After it was created in 1971, City and Industrial Development Corporation (CIDCO) was the only authority that looked after the development and maintenance of the city. It was CIDCO which prepared the developmental plan for Navi Mumbai covering 95 villages. In 1991, Navi Mumbai Municipal Corporation (NMMC) was constituted by the Maharashtra government for maintaining some of the developed nodes of Navi Mumbai, namely, Belapur, Nerul, Turbhe, Koparkhairane, Ghansoli, Airoli,and Vashi. 
Navi Mumbai is home to many software companies of Maharashtra, located in various parks. These include the Millennium Business Park in Mahape, the International InfoTech Park at Vashi, and the Belapur railway station complex. It is also home to major commodity markets as well as a major steel market. One of the important business landmarks is the shipping port of Jawaharlal Nehru Port in the Nhava Sheva – Dronagiri nodes. The major business hubs in the city are CBD Belapur, Vashi, Nerul, and Mahape. The Navi Mumbai Special Economic Zone (SEZ) located in the nodes of Dronagiri and Kalamboli is planned to provide commercial growth and employment to the city. Positioned enroute the proposed Navi Mumbai Airport, this megaproject has attracted investments close to Rs 40,000 crores. 

2) New Town, Kolkata 

New Town, formerly known as Rajarhat, is a fast emerging satellite township in Kolkata Metropolitan Area (KMA) and it is expected that it will be able to absorb additional population growth and help in easing the burden on Kolkata. The West Bengal Housing and Infrastructure Development Corporation (HIDCO) plans and executes development projects in the entire 6,000 – 7,000 hectare area in New Town. In order to render the various civic services and amenities within New Town, the New Town Kolkata Development Authority (NKDA) was constituted under the New Town Kolkata Development Authority Act, 2007. 
Towns master plan envisages a township at least three times bigger than the neighbouring planned Salt Lake City. The entire area is still under the process of development. As a planned township, New Town has been divided into three key areas: Action Area I, which mainly consists of malls, a sub Central Business District (CBD) and planned residential and commercial plots. Action Area II is to have a planned main CBD, institutional plots, IT Business Parks like DLF and Unitech, and plots for large apartment complexes. Action Area III mainly consists of high rise residential complexes and mini sub-townships like Uniworld City and Sukhobristi. 

3) Lavasa 

Lavasa is a private, planned city being built near Pune by the Hindustan Construction Company (HCC). Among the first planned hill cities of India, Lavasa is approximately 1/5th of the land area of the Municipal Corporation of Greater Mumbai. Located near the Mumbai-Pune economic corridor, along the Warasgaon Lake, Lavasa optimally balances nature and urban infrastructure. The master plan of Lavasa is based on the principles of New Urbanism which makes life easy for its residents by placing all essential components of daily life within walking distance of each other. Besides this, architectural considerations such as land character, building frontage, and other design guidelines have also been taken into consideration while making the master plan. 

Developments at Lavasa are well on schedule, and the Dasve town center is currently under an advanced stage development. While the Dasve Town Centre is already functional, all structures in education, hospitality, and leisure are fast-nearing completion. Mugaon, is 6 kms from Dasve and is being developed as a centre for residential, educational, business and commercial activities. This town has shops, cafes, cultural institutions, spiritual centres, schools, and colleges.

What is Zonal Plan

 Zonal development plans are the next level hierarchical policy plans after the master plans which detail out the broad objectives of the master plan at comparatively smaller regions while incorporating the guidelines and proposals by the master plan without deviating far from the primary goal of development set by master plan. Unlike master plans here these zonal plans are prepared for shorter terms with more focus on detailing. 

The Zonal Development Plan details out the policy of the master plan and acts as a link between the layout and the master plan. Indian master plan approach was fundamentally guided by the British town planning legislation. And further integrating the western concept of ‘zoning’ into the master planning lead to the preparation of new lower hierarchy development plans called ‘zonal development plan’ handling more comprehensive and more focused objectives derived from the master plan. 

As the city is in its initial stage of growth there is urban agglomeration taking place into the city which usually derived due to one or a few unique characteristics spreading almost homogeneous throughout the city. But as the city keeps growing bigger, there are different new characteristics brushed without the prior knowledge on different parts of the city holding huge population. This arises new problems with solutions generally out of the scope of the single character oriented Master plans which treats the whole city equal and develops the regulations based on the common or prominent character of the city with major aspects in detail. Also it is impossible to advocate these changes into the master plan due to its long term visionary approach. 

At this point the Authorities have come up with such inspiring solution of preparation of separate development plans for different smaller regions called zones which are divided based on the broad prevailing character of the area. Now, having an opportunity of independent planning for each zone, these zonal development plans put their focus on those sub objectives developed according to the uniqueness of the zones. Coming to the question of legality of the zonal development plans, though both zonal plans and master plans are approved and authorized equally by the State Governments, any changes or amendments are directed only towards the statutory master plan which reflects those changes onto the lower hierarchy plans further. Most development authorities prefer the development of these zonal plans simultaneously with the preparation of the Master plans to provide immediate aid as tool to the Master plan implementation at ground level.

What are Important Aspects of Preparing Master Plan for a Town

 In the beginning, a ‘Master Plan’ is prepared, which identifies the long-range, comprehensive planning by or for a government agency as a foundation for the overall land development policies within specific corporate limits. The master plan deals with the natural city or a town as a whole. It offers a broad, general picture of the projected spatial pattern of the total metropolis. Three aspects of the master plan may be studied, each of which represents a major historical emphasis on city planning. 

1) Land Use Pattern 

Planning for effective use of land within the town/city limits involves decisions regarding: 

  • The various types of utilization that require distinctive subareas. 
  • The percentage of the total occupied space that should be apportioned to each type and the grade of utilization. 
  • The proper location within the city/town of each type of functional area. 

2) Land Utilization 

The master plan or the general plan has to give scope to various categories of land utilization, both public and private. Three major categories of private land use are common stores, factories and residences each may be subdivided further. Factories may be separated into at least two subtypes, Tight’ and ‘heavy.’ Residences may be divided into three subcategories by value low, medium and high and into two or more subcategories according to the intensiveness of utilization. 

Commercial establishments may be divided into subcategories such as wholesale and retail, with the latter further subdivided. In addition, storage and switching facilities may require separate areas in connection with heavy transportation lines. Public land utilization, such as parks, playgrounds and civic centres, also have to be provided for in the city plan. However, the most extensive form of public land utilization streets spread throughout the city is in no need for a separate demarcation of space. 

3) Spatial Locations for Each Category

In determining the spatial location for each category, various types and grades of subareas available in the city are indicated on the master plan map. The planner then considers the following to determine which land has to be allotted to which category. 

  • The kinds of services to be performed within the city. 
  • The ideal locations for stores, factories and residences. 
  • Significant characteristics of the urban site that suits this ideal pattern. 
  • The existing heritage of the past construction that gives the city its present spatial pattern. 
  • The trends of the spatial change that already have started but have not run their full course. 
  • Anticipated effects of any new inventions. 

With these considerations in mind, the planner undertakes to formulate a general map of the most efficient spatial pattern. This plan is usually effected within a time span of 20 to 50 years. The planner has to recommend to appropriate officials such controls and changes as will further the realization of this pattern. The ideal master plan places every category and subcategory in a subarea of a city that 

  • The total cost of moving men and materials from place is minimized 
  • Safety and beauty are maximized 
  • Constructive social contacts are stimulated 

In formulating these proposals, the planner can utilize a generalized description of the ideal spatial pattern of a city or study the various types of city planning recommended by the experts.He needs to make detailed studies of the unique characteristics of each city and to modify the generalized ideal pattern so as to fit the local conditions and needs. For an already existing city/town, the urban planner ordinarily finds that the basic pattern of heavy transportation already has been established. The major system of streets has been laid out and the locations of the central business district and of major secondary commercial centres have been fixed, and that many areas of light and heavy industries have been established. Even though he must begin with this existing pattern and has numerous decisions to make regarding future changes.

Slum Clearance 

Many cities contain extensive areas of closely packed deteriorated dwellings, often called slums. To make the city more beautiful, the local authorities have to undertake to raze a few blocks of slum dwellings and to build new residences. At such times, city planning officials may be asked to study the local area and to make recommendations about its spatial layout. If a slum clearance project is to cover only one of several deteriorated sections of a city, the planner may first be asked to make recommendations as to which specific locality should be rebuilt. In carrying out this preliminary task, he starts with some estimate of land space that will be needed and proceeds to select one or more areas of that size. In deciding which area to recommend for reconstruction, he collects the data covering such points as follows. 

  • The number of structures unfit for human use. 
  • The number of dwelling units lacking adequate lighting. 
  • Delinquency rates. 
  • Income to the city from taxes as compared with the costs of expenditure on the police and health services. 

The planner should also take into account the location of various deteriorated areas as related to the anticipated changes in the total spatial pattern of the city. He then recommends for rebuilding only such areas as will be needed for residential utilization throughout the normal life of the proposed new dwellings. The planner then presents all these data to the officials.Based on all these data, the officials then select a slum area for clearance. The planner then has to prepare a map showing the recommended pattern of land utilization. He has to estimate the amount of space needed by store, shops, schools and playgrounds. He should also decide on the preferred locations for each type of utilization. 

He has to then recommend on how much of land has be utilized for residential purposes and also indicate the size and location of individual structures on a map. Usually on an in lying slum clearance area, the structures rebuilt are aimed at multifamily, low cost residences, generally fewer in number and higher in grade than those replaced. If a considerable slum area is cleared at one time, the planner can ignore the previous pattern of streets and can shape the area almost as if he were beginning with vacant land. Ideally, he places heavy traffic streets only among the edges of a neighbourhood and uses narrow, curved secondary streets to divide the neighbourhood into large residential super blocks, and provide necessary access to and from homes. These features of local street plans for slum clearance areas are much like those characteristics of the peripheral preplanned communities. 

Streets and Transportation Facilities 

The planning of streets and transportation facilities relates so intimately to the spatial structure of the city that the two cannot be separated. The major function of urban transportation is that of connecting one area with another so that men and materials can move with greater safety and less cost. Sometimes, some specific projects may create problems for transportation. Thus, a multiplicity of transportation and communication facilities confronts the city planner. Some facilities link the city with the hinterland and some others link with other cities, towns and villages. 

City planning has to deal with the routes of heavy transportation and location of terminal facilities and other problems that involve street use. It should also take into consideration the congestion and danger created by the large volume and potentially high speed of urban street traffic. Three aspects have to be considered while planning the streets, traffic counts and calculation of street requirements, elimination of bottlenecks and dangerous intersections, and special high-speed expressways and bypass routes. 

Traffic Counts and Major Street Pattern 

Sound planning of the major street system requires for the quantitative determination of needs. To determine these needs, the traffic engineers count the number of vehicles using each major street at different hours of the day and on various days of the week. Such traffic counts measure the total volume of traffic and the size and hours of peak loads. Sometimes, the engineers have to survey the origin and destination of the traffic to determine how much traffic can conveniently be diverted from the more congested streets to alternate routes. Using such data, engineers calculate the number and width of streets needed and make recommendations for new construction or for changes in the existing streets. 

Elimination of Bottlenecks and Dangerous Intersections 

One best method of lessening the traffic congestion on certain streets is the elimination of bottlenecks. If, throughout most of its length, a busy road is broad enough to handle the ordinary volume of traffic, then there will not be any problem of congestion. But at any point on the road, there is a narrow street or a bridge, it interferes in the ordinary movement of the traffic. The planner usually recommends the widening of such narrow places. 

Sometimes, if the bottleneck results from on street parking, the planner has to recommend the elimination of the practice or he may introduce a system of ‘one-way’ traffic streets. If peak loads result in congestion during morning and evening hours, and if the highway has four or more traffic lanes, the planner may recommend the use of movable directional signs so placed as to permit a greater number of lanes to be used in the direction of heavier traffic. 

Another major problem is traffic intersection or traffic caused due to intersecting streets. Collision and injuries are common at such places, which can be greatly reduced by overpasses and underpasses. These can eliminate cross traffic. At times, the planners can work out a system that provides for entrances and exits to facilitate the movement between cross streets or intersecting streets. 

The planners can provide for two special categories of highways to manage the traffic – high speed expressways and bypass routes. The former should ordinarily extend from the city centre outward through less populous areas into the hinterland. Such expressways can be entered only at designated points, with entrance and exit lanes especially designed to lessen the danger and to minimize interference with speeding traffic. The second highway should provide for slow traffic. These routes should lead through traffic around rather than through areas of congestion. Thus, planners can recommend a number of methods to overcome bottlenecks including the barriers caused due to pedestrian traffic.

Gandhinagar Master Plan – Case Study

 

Gandhinagar is located 23 km north of Ahemdabad planned in 1960s by Prakash M Apte and H. K. Mewada. Gandhinagar district is an administrative division of Gujarat, India, whose headquarters are at Gandhinagar, the state capital. It was organized in 1964. Gandhinagar is located in central Gujarat, Vadodra and Ahemdabad are located in the north. It is a planned city situated on the Ahmedabad, Gandhinagar is the commercial heart of Gujarat and western India. Gandhinagar is being developed as infocity. It has an area of 649 km², and a population of 13,34,455.

Streets 

Gandhinagar’s streets are numbered (eg. Road no. 1, Road no. 2 up to Road no. 7). All streets are aligned at 30 deg. N-W and 60 deg. N-E, to avoid direct glare of morning and evening sun while driving. The Gujarat assembly building is in the centre of the city to make it close to all the residents

Character of the City 

Infocity, Gandhinagar has many educational institutions like Dhirubhai Ambani Institute of ICT (Information and Communication Technology), EDI (Entrepreneurship Development Institute Of India), Indian Plasma Research Institute, and Gujarat Law University. Gandhinagar’s Education level is highest in Gujarat, 87.11% all over the Gujarat. 

Sectors 

Gandhinagar has 30 sectors which are of 1 x 0.75 km each in length and width. Each sector has a primary school, a secondary school, a higher secondary school, a medical dispensary, a shopping centre and a maintenance office. Gandhinagar is developed on the neighborhood concept.

Planned as the administrative capital of the state, the current and future population employed in state government offices was distributed in 30 residential sectors around the State Assembly secretariat complex. Each residential sector could accommodate about 50% of population, and was intended to house the half of the population employed by the government. Plots on the periphery of each sector are meant for private and supporting population that constitutes the remaining 50%. The city was planned for a population of 150,000 but can accommodate double that population with increase in the floor space ratio from 1 to 2 in the areas reserved for private development. The river being the border on the east, and the industrial area to the North, the most logical future physical expansion of the city was envisaged towards the north-west. 

To establish and maintain a separate identity for the new city, the surrounding area of about 39 villages was brought under a Periphery Control Act (as in Chandigarh) that permitted new development of farm houses only. The area later constituted a separate administrative district of Gandhinagar. The city was planned for a population of 150,000 but can accommodate double that population with increase in the floor space ratio from 1 to 2 in the areas reserved for private development. The river being the border on the east, and the industrial area to the north, the most logical future physical expansion of the city was envisaged towards the north- west. 

Due to a constant military confrontation with Pakistan, whose borders are close from the city, a large military presence was required here. The land acquired on the eastern bank, adjacent to National Highway No.8, was therefore allotted to the Border Security Force and military cantonment. Considering the mostly south-west to north-east wind direction, the land to the north of the city was allotted for the then biggest thermal power station and the adjacent areas were zoned for industrial use. This area was distanced from the township by a 2000 ft. wide green strip of thick vegetation.

The New Plan (2002) 

The consultants recently appointed by GUDA have ignored that history and want the expansion of the city to take place to the south. A southward expansion proposed by the consultants will merge it with Ahmedabad and finally become its suburb, destroying its separate identity. This extension to the south has completely destroyed the plan’s most important concept, the central vista (Road No.4). It focuses on the capitol complex, and was naturally to be extended to the north-west maintaining the axis, expanding the city physically in that direction. Over 6000 acres of green cover to the south west of the city has been designated for residential use in an attempt to join with the city of Ahmedabad. All this land, when developed can accommodate a population of over 600,000. The consultants thus seek to destroy the identity of the new capital city and make it a suburb of Ahmedabad. The “Gamthan” (built up land in a village) areas of 7 villages just abutting the city limits of Gandhinagar are increased arbitrarily (much beyond their natural growth requirements) to allow private residential development. 

Dismantling of Important Urban Design Features 

A major Area for cultural facilities, in the city square in Sector 17 of the city centre is proposed to be converted to commercial use, killing Gujarat’s traditional concept of a ‘city square’ and destroying a major element of ‘urban design’ of the new capital city. An area along J road (along the river Sabarmati) across Sector 9 covered by ravines, was proposed for conservation as an adventure park. It is now designated by the consultants for residential taking away a unique recreational facility. The open spaces at the junctions of all main roads of the city, left open in the original plan to improve road geometrics in future, ornamental landscaping, road signage, guide maps etc. are proposed to be filled up with roadside petty shops and hutments for the immigrants giving the city a slum like look.

To understand these types of controls, it is important to recognize the design objectives, design principles and design guidelines. Objectives are statements of what a design is to achieve. The objectives of an urban design scheme are inevitably a mixture of economic, behavioral and aesthetic ends. Principles are statements describing and explaining the links between a desired design objective and a pattern or layout of the environment. The set of design principles used repetitively by a designer is loosely called that person’s style. A guideline is a statement, which specifies (for uninformed people) how to meet a design objective. They are also known as design directives. A guideline is an operational definition of an objective. There are two types of guidelines: prescriptive and performance oriented. 
Performance oriented guidelines are essentially the same as design objectives, prescriptive guidelines are based on design principles and are as good or as bad as those principles. With prescriptive guidelines the designer of the guidelines works out what kind of pattern is required of the built environment. In performance guidelines it is left to the designer of the individual components of the urban design scheme to do. Design based on prescriptive guidelines is easier to evaluate; performance guidelines, while encouraging divergent thinking, require considerably more effort to ensure that the objectives are actually met. Guidelines are frequently used not simply to inform designers but as design controls. Design controls in cities are always shaped by the invisible web of law specifying individual and communal rights, the nature of the market place and the allowable mechanisms for interfering in the market place on behalf of perceptions of the public interest. As such it complements the capital web of investment policies used by governments to shape the environment. Urban design controls reform aspects of both webs.

What are Stages of Preparation and Method of Execution of Development Plan

 It includes Planning department of the local government, Specialized planning organization, A consultant and State town planning department. General methods normally followed for the preparation are: 

  1. Collection of data and relevant information from civic survey and other sources 
  2. Preparation of a tentative draft of the development plan and notifying the same for comments, suggestions and discussions from experts and the public 
  3. Considerations of views received from experts and the public with sympathy and without any prejudice 
  4. Preparation of the revised development plan accommodating the good aspects of comments received from experts and the public.
  5. Determination of the sequence in which the development plan will be implemented.

Method of Execution

The execution of the development plan is carried out by the Municipal or Corporation authorities. The first thing to be determined is the layout of the road system. It requires a functional approach to the more important sociological aspects of the town, viz. ‘Folk, Place and Work’. Lastly a financial program is prepared to devise the ways and means for the implementation of the Development Plan according to the schedule. For execution a team of experts in Engineering, Architecture, Public health, Sociology, Economics, Finance etc. headed by a Town Planner is required. 
The plan making and plan implementation are inseparable. The interim development plan also called the Outline Development Plan is thus prepared by the planning authority. The statutory time limit is two years. It shall then be notified for the public comments and suggestions (Time one month). The Draft plan may be revised in the light of the public and expert comments and shall be submitted for Government’s sanction. (Four months from date of publication of the draft plan. The Govt. sanctions the revised plan and appoints an arbitrator.

The Arbitrator after holding proceedings in respect of each plot publishes the award and submits the detailed proposals to the higher authority such as the President of the Tribunal of Arbitration (No fixed time limit but at least twelve months for small scheme). The Arbitrator prepares the final scheme and submits to Govt. with plans through the local authority (usually six months). The local authority forwards the final scheme to the Govt. (usually three months). Govt. sanctions the final scheme after the photo zinco Dept., has printed all the plans. The detailed Development Plan also called the comprehensive Development Plan is duly approved and sanctioned by the Govt.
